Moses will be declared the winner. However, because the Race was aborted and did not end properly, there is no Podium Ceremony. Maxwell Rutter, who leads the Ceremony, will go to a couple of areas outside of the Pit Building then go back inside and to his Office where he will stay for the duration of the mission. Even if you acquire the Moses Lee Disguise and wait at the Building he will never come and you cannot get one of the Ceremony Challenges as a result thus I will do that in a later run-through.

After causing the Race to end then run to the Emergency Bay. Go into the Storage Room to switch into the Medic Disguise and pick open the Cabinet to get the Modern Lethal Syringe. Go into the Treatment Area and turn on the Sink at the northeast corner to lure the Doctor and then the Sink inside the Restroom after the Driver leaves. After that then poison the IV Drip, leave the Bay, and run to the Speedboat.

Sierra has a vitamin and dehydration session with the Doctor but can't do it until the Driver leaves regardless of method. Once he leaves then she can go to the Doctor. He will place the IV into her to revitalize her but, because you poisoned the Drip, she will die instead. Once she drops dead then you can leave the mission.

By doing this run-through you should also complete the following Challenges in the process:

  • Deja Due [4,000 XP]: For this you need to shoot a Pigeon at Robert's Office from the South Overpass.
  • The Man And The Sea [2,000 XP]: For this you need to kill Robert with the Trophy Fish at the Pier.
  • Red Flag [2,000 XP]: For this you need to force the Race to be aborted by creating multiple crashes.
  • Vitamin Overdose [4,000 XP]: For this you need to make the Doctor kill Sierra with the poisoned IV Drip.
  • Tasteless, Traceless [2,000 XP]: For this you need to kill a Target with lethal poison.
  • Slice Of Vice [2,000 XP]: For this you need to use the Speedboat to leave the mission.

For [Ocular Administration] you need to kill Robert by poisoning his Eye Drops on the 1st Floor of the Bayside Center and for [Don't Drive and Drink] you need to kill Sierra by poisoning the Trophy at the Podium Building. This will also use a strategically placed game save to acquire additional Challenges involving Robert.

When planning bring the Lethal Poison Vial, Lockpick, place the Fiber Wire into the Parking Garage, and start at the Dolphin Fountain. Again, grab the Crowbar and go up to the 1st Floor Maintenance Room to acquire the Kronstadt Security Disguise, Emetic Rat Poison, and the Bayside Center Keycard.

Go down to the Parking Garage to grab the Fiber Wire then go up to the 1st Floor and to the Restroom by the Security Area.

Here you should find Robert's Eye Drops. Before doing anything to it you should go to his Office and, while avoiding the Enforcer, find the Air Conditioning Controls on the wall just west of the desk. Set it to Dry Mode then go back to the Restroom.

Robert has an eye condition caused by the accident that ended his career. The Office is kept at high humidity as a result. Tampering with the Air Conditioning will dry it out and irritate his eyes. So he will go to the Restroom to use his Eye Drops.

When you return to the Restroom then make a game save:

  • Hold My Hair [2,000 XP]: Use the Emetic Rat Poison on the Drops and wait just inside the toilet. When he uses them then he will get sick and come here. Drown him then reload the save after the notifications pop up.
  • Piano Man [1,000 XP]: When you get back then use the emetic poison on the drops again then garrote him when he comes to the toilet. After the notifications pop up then reload the save again.

When you get back then use the Lethal Poison Vial on the Drops then leave the building. When he uses them then he will drop dead.

After leaving the building then run to the Emergency Bay's Storage Room to find the Lethal Poison Pill Jar. Run to the Podium Building and go up to where the Trophy is being kept. Poison the Trophy then go to the Race Marshal Area.

You need to end the Race and one of the easiest ways is to disqualify someone. Carefully switch into the Race Marshal Disguise that is on the table and go over to the platform next to the South Overpass. Grab the Flag and wait.

When both Sierra and Moses come into view then Disqualify Moses Lee to end the Race with Sierra as the winner. Head over to the Sewers and wait. When Sierra eventually drinks from the Trophy during the Ceremony then she will drop dead and you can leave the mission.

By doing this run-through you should also complete the following Challenges in the process:

  • Hold My Hair [2,000 XP]: For this you need to kill a Target by drowning them.
  • Piano Man [1,000 XP]: For this you need to kill a Target by garroting them.
  • The Odd One Out [1,000 XP]: For this you need to disqualify Moses Lee.
